Studies were conducted to explore the synthesis of retinol-binding protein and transthyretin by embryonic and extraembryonic tissues during fetal development in the rat. The levels of retinol-binding protein mRNA and transthyretin mRNA were measured in fetal liver and in extraembryonic tissues by RNA gel blot analysis and hybridization with specific cDNA probes. The reliability of single time point measurements of the novel adipokines retinol-binding protein 4 and omentin-1 in the blood has not been evaluated in large samples yet. The present study aimed to assess the amount of biological variation of these two adipokines within individuals. Retinol-binding protein 4 (RBP4), the sole retinol transporter in blood, is secreted from adipocytes and liver. Serum RBP4 levels correlate highly with insulin resistance, other metabolic syndrome factors, and cardiovascular disease.
